Title of Position: Organizational Development Specialist - Endwell, NY

Position Type: Full-Time. Typical shifts include Monday through Friday 8:00AM to 5:00PM

Compensation Range: $23/Hr - $30/Hr. *Hiring rates may be dependent on a number of factors, including years of directly related work experience, education, geographic location or special skills*

Location: Headquarters - 3301 Country Club Rd, Endwell, NY 13760. Hybrid opportunity may be available after training is completed.

Responsibilities/Duties:



  • Manage new hire orientation and first day experience. Additionally, responsible for maintaining presentation and material disbursement, welcome kits and orientation survey results.
  • Orchestrate and conduct new hire luncheons with the CEO, other senior leaders, and designated speakers and monthly Loop Onboarding meetings with new hires.
  • Responsible for decision making for annual changes to the New Hire Passport and updates throughout the year.
  • Manage and own the instructor-led training schedules for all in person training of with the Learning and Development (L&D) training team in partnership with the L&D Manager.
  • Coordinate with managers to arrange training for their staff and follow up as needed after training.
  • Partner and communicate with trainers to ensure they are informed and prepared for classes and any scheduling changes that may occur.
  • Responsible for quarterly Overdraft Privilege Classes, including scheduling, sending invitations and tracking of participant attendance.
  • Order and prepare workbooks and other materials needed for classes.
  • Collaborate with the Director of Organizational Development to maintain Visions' people management program in The Loop. Owns and conduct training and reinforcement of Manager Tools within the Loop for teams across the organization.
  • Serve as the point of contact for updating content and calendars within KXP.
  • Manage the ILT Calendar in BAI.
  • Act as the BAI administrator, creating rules, assigning classes, and troubleshooting issues as needed.
  • Own, in partnership with the eLearning Team, execution of the eLearning compliance program at Visions.
  • Collaborate with eLearning team and manager on compliance rule assignments.
  • Track leaves and compliance completions for rule closure.
  • Prepare completion reports for audits.
  • Updates and maintains people groups in BAI.
